Day: December 22, 2012

stockholm today cajsa warg food shop
Food Shopping Sightseeing Stockholm Tips

Best Christmas food in Stockholm

Where to buy your Christmas food in Stockholm? Some of the best places are in Östermalmshallen, Hötorgshallen, and a lovely small grocery shop in Södermalm called Cajsa Warg. Here is a picture from Cajsa Warg. Now they have a wonderful selection of Christmas food, ham, sausages, cheese, Swedish Julmust and other must have food items […]

Read More